Examine the Weight
Authentic Rolex watches possess a certain heft due to their high-quality materials and robust craftsmanship. Counterfeit models often compromise on this aspect, using lighter components that reduce overall weight. If you have the opportunity to handle a timepiece, hold it in your hand and assess its feel against your expectations.
Most genuine Rolexes weigh between 130 to 200 grams, depending on the model. For example, the Submariner typically weighs around 150 grams. If a model significantly deviates from this range, it raises a red flag. An overly lightweight piece may indicate inferior materials, such as cheap metal or plastic, rather than the premium stainless steel or gold found in authentic versions.
To further evaluate, compare the weight of the watch with an official specification chart provided on Rolex's website or through certified dealers. Inconsistencies are a strong indicator of a non-genuine product. Additionally, consider the presence of manual winding or automatic movements; mechanical watches generally weigh more than their quartz counterparts. An unexpectedly light piece could signal a battery-operated movement disguised as a luxury item.
Using a precise scale can help verify the weight accurately. If you find yourself uncertain, seeking the guidance of an expert or a certified jeweler can provide additional assurance regarding the authenticity of the watch in question.
Understanding Material Quality
Quality of materials plays a pivotal role in distinguishing genuine timepieces from imitations. Authentic models often incorporate high-grade stainless steel, particularly the 904L variant, known for its corrosion resistance and enduring polish. A counterfeit might utilize lesser grades, leading to a dull appearance and susceptibility to scratches.
Examine the weight; original pieces are typically heavier due to the density of premium materials. A lightweight imitation often signals poor craftsmanship. Additionally, pay attention to the presence of gold or platinum elements. Authentic Rolex models utilize 18k gold and high-quality platinum, which are distinctly different in shade and softness compared to their fake counterparts.
The crystal material is another telling factor. Genuine watches feature scratch-resistant sapphire crystal, while replicas might employ weaker alternatives. Observe this through lighting; authentic sapphire exhibits a unique brilliance and clarity, further amplified by anti-reflective coating.
Lastly, the bracelet and clasp deserve scrutiny. Genuine links exhibit flawless finishing and tight tolerances, while replicas often display uneven gaps and rough edges. Check for engravings on clasps, as they should possess distinct and precise markings, unlike those found on counterfeit models.

Feeling the Mechanics
Understanding the inner workings of a luxury watch can significantly aid in distinguishing it from a counterfeit. Genuine models are equipped with precision movements, often manufactured in-house. Here are key aspects to examine:
- Movement Sound: Authentic Rolex watches produce a soft and smooth ticking noise due to their automatic movements. If the ticking is loud or irregular, this may indicate a lack of quality craftsmanship.
- Sweeping Seconds Hand: A hallmark of true luxury timepieces, the seconds hand on a genuine watch glides smoothly across the dial. Counterfeits often exhibit a ticking motion, moving in discrete increments.
- Case Back: Check the case back carefully. Real Rolex watches typically have a solid case back, except for some models like the Sea-Dweller. Engravings on the case back should be precise and clear, with no signs of superficial etchings or inconsistencies.
- Weight: Authentic pieces are constructed from high-quality materials that contribute to their weight. If it feels unexpectedly light, this might indicate inferior materials.
Focusing on these mechanics not only enhances your appreciation for the craftsmanship but also assists in confirming the watch's authenticity.
